About The Position

Landing Gear Stress Analyst for the F-35 Program. The successful candidate will be able to perform structural analysis on new and revised designs of landing gear parts and mechanisms. Responsible for static strength assessment, an understanding of internal gas and fluid pressures, gear strokes, and retract and extension mechanisms. You will work directly with designers to convey requirements and to verify compliant products. You will employ fundamental and complex engineering analysis to structurally size parts for the severe environment of a fifth generation fighter jet and autonomous aircraft. You will use cutting edge analytical tools including Hypermesh, Nastran, Patran, Abaqus, Mathcad, as well as Lockheed Martin proprietary tools in your evaluations. You will apply your knowledge of engineering mechanics, including Engineering Statics, Dynamics, Strength of Materials, and Fluids.
